http://maxdenver.com/blog1/2010/08/29/what-to-watch-broncos-steelers/#more-1050

DENVER – There’s plenty to examine tonight, but above all, here’s three areas to watch tonight as the Broncos face the Steelers …

WHO’S ON THE RUN? It could be Correll Buckhalter, although he acknowledged as he returned to practice that being ready for tonight might not be possible. “I’m a little older now, so I don’t know if I can just jump right in,” he said last Tuesday. “I have to take it day-by-day and work myself in.”

That could place the spotlight squarely on LenDale White tonight — assuming he’s healthy enough to play after missing the last two weeks. White practiced Wednesday and Thursday in an orange “no-contact” jersey but was in a regular white jersey Friday — as was Buckhalter.

The Broncos know what they’ll get with Buckhalter, and he doesn’t necessarily need the preseason work to be ready for Week 1. With White, it’s a different story; he was not in a training camp before the Broncos signed him in early August and is after an unstable offseason that included a trade to — and release from — Seattle, he needs to show his worth to justify a place on the roster after he serves his four-game suspension.

Among the other three runners — Justin Fargas, Bruce Hall and Lance Ball — someone needs to step up. Hall and Ball had their moments last week. For Hall, the moment was an outstanding fourth-quarter series, where he ran with decisiveness and power. Ball overcame a tip-drill interception that skipped off his hands to catch a touchdown pass from Kyle Orton.

PASS RUSH FROM OLBs: Jarvis Moss turned in a stellar performance last week, dominating the Lions during the third quarter. But most of that work was at the expense of second- and third-teamers. Tonight, Moss is expected to play extensively with the first unit. Another good night in pass rush — especially with some snaps expected to come against the fleet Dennis Dixon — could put the Broncos at ease as they continue to compensate for the loss of Elvis Dumervil.

The other question on the pass rush revolves around how well Moss and Robert Ayers can complement each other. Their builds, skill sets and roles are different, but Ayers already has a sack and multiple pressures in three quarters of first-team work so far this summer.

THE LEFT SIDE OF THE LINE: At the start, it’s expected to consist of Zane Beadles at left tackle and Stanley Daniels at left guard. This isn’t an indictment on Beadles’ play at left guard, where he’s started the last two weeks; rather, it’s a chance for the Broncos to get a look at Beadles at his college position and see whether he can fill in for Ryan Clady should the need arise.

“With any player, it’s always good to have someone who can do different things – whether it’s a guy that can play both guard and center or tackle and guard,” offensive line coach Clancy Barone said. “It always makes your job easier as a football coach.”

The need for left tackle depth is key; even if Clady plays at Jacksonville in two weeks, he might not be able to take every snap. Further, moving the first-team left guard out to left tackle is a trait of the Patriots-originated offensive system. Carolina, whose offense is coordinated by ex-New England assistant Jeff Davidson, moved left guard Travelle Wharton to left tackle when its Pro Bowl tackle (Jordan Gross), broke his leg last November.
